STATE v. PATTERSON

No. 05-84-00094-CR.

668 S.W.2d 462 (1984)

STATE of Texas and Don Byrd, Appellants, v. John PATTERSON, Appellee.

Court of Appeals of Texas, Dallas.

Rehearing Denied March 14, 1984.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Henry Wade, Dist. Atty., Greg Long, Asst. Dist. Atty., for appellants.

John Byers, Dallas, for appellee.

Before GUITTARD, C.J., and STEWART and SHUMPERT, JJ.


PER CURIAM.

The State of Texas sought appellate review of an order granting a writ of habeas corpus. We dismissed the appeal on the ground that the State has no right to review, and the State has moved for reconsideration. We adhere to our ruling.
